Dr. Lyndly Tamura is a specialist in physiatry (physical medicine & rehabilitation) and orthopedics/orthopedic surgery. She works in San Rafael, CA, Larkspur, CA, and San Francisco, CA. Her areas of clinical interest consist of foot surgery, pain management, and ankle surgery. Her hospital/clinic affiliations include Marin General Hospital (MGH) and Hill Physicians. Dr. Tamura graduated from the University of Toledo College of Medicine. For her residency, Dr. Tamura trained at Stanford University Medical Center. She has received professional recognition including the following: The University of Toledo College of Medicine and Life Sciences; Resident Safety Council Project Multidisciplinary Winner, Stanford University; and Eleanore Coghlin Award for Medical School Excellence in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ation.
